On 11 May, an item ordered, entered the Royal Mail. By about 15th May it was in the SA Postal Service possession. From then, to 28th May it disappeared. On 28th May at 06h18 it was finally scanned at the JIMC with the South African tracking number RI***ZA. <br> Since the 28th, it has not moved (at time of writing this, 7 days+ later).<br> I understood, from the George Post Office that the item goes through Customs and enters the Postal system. From Ms Huyser, it seems it enters the Postal system, then goes to Customs.<br> Whatever the procedure, it is dawdling in Johannesburg.<br> The more it dawdles, the better the chance that it will be lost.<br> My specific complaint is that it is the Post Office' specific purpose to receive, transmit and deliver mail timeously and in an acceptable condition. This they are not doing.<br> Someone else received a parcel from overseas within 10 days. Why is this dragging. I have been to the PM of George, the Area PM and the SAPO CustomerCare. They are taking detail and, in the main, not following up. The SAPO Track & Trace has not worked for weeks. I use a 3rd party Track & Trace!<br> SAPO is going the same way as Eskom!<br>
